Crynodeb
Monitor and review patient care and/or treatment progress using the Patient Tracking List in line with Trust and local policies. Identify from the Tracking List the next steps in the patient care pathway in line with clinical need (peer review). Receive patient referrals and administer in line with timings and requirements as set out in Trust and National policies. Co-ordinate and provide administrative support to the relevant teams to ensure that all the relevant paperwork and clinical information is available. Update on all enquiries regarding patients care and/or treatment on a pathway from external Trusts and General Practitioners in a timely manner. Develop an understanding of the milestones of the allocated pathway for patients within a designated group. Plan and organise multi-disciplinary team meetings. Attend relevant meetings and complete actions regarding the care of patients within the designated pathway. Participate in national audits and collect data as required in relevant meetings, allowing the Trust to identify and improve treatment in patient cohorts. Identify and suggest improvements that can be made to the patient care pathway and/or the patient pathway tracking process. Monitor patients on their pathway and proactively find resolutions to improve the speed of treatment by working directly with clinicians and managers. Action day-to-day issues, ensuring resolution and escalating serious issues to management as appropriate. Escalate any issues and breaches of the Waiting Times standards to the relevant management in line with agreed escalation procedures. Ensure the timely and efficient transfer of patients and information between trusts/other organisations involved in the patient pathway, adhering to agreed communication pathways and protocols. Work within a multi-disciplinary team in developing the service in line with departmental plans and Trust corporate objectives. Ensure that all health records are appropriately tracked and securely stored whilst in the department according to Health Records Policy.
